DESCRIPTION
The intake mass air flow meter assembly consists of a platinum hot wire, temperature sensor and control circuit installed in a plastic housing. The temperature sensor (located in the intake air by-pass of the housing) detects the intake air temperature.
There is little variation in the output from the intake mass air flow meter assembly, as it is hardly affected by the resistance of the wire harness.
The internal circuit of the intake mass air flow meter assembly contains a hot wire and cold wire. A voltage is output through a bridge circuit (refer to the illustration) indicating the cooling of the hot wire according to the intake air amount. This voltage is then converted into a periodic signal by the periodic signal conversion circuit and output to the ECM. The frequency varies between approximately 1945 and 8500 Hz depending on the air flow rate. The ECM calculates the mass air flow rate based on this frequency.

Tech Tips
If DTC P0102 is stored, the following symptoms may appear (as the ECM mistakenly determines that there is less air than the actual intake air amount, EGR is decreased according to the target EGR):
Combustion noise worsens
If DTC P0103 is stored, the following symptoms may appear (as the ECM mistakenly determines that there is more air than the actual intake air amount, EGR is increased according to the target EGR):
Misfire
White smoke
Black smoke

Tech Tips
Read freeze frame data using the GTS. Freeze frame data records the engine condition when malfunctions are detected. When troubleshooting, freeze frame data can help determine if the vehicle was moving or stationary, if the engine was warmed up or not, and other data from the time the malfunction occurred.
